Duncan P. N. Exon Smith 09b5c9c24d IR: Give 'DI' prefix to debug info metadata
Finish off PR23080 by renaming the debug info IR constructs from `MD*`
to `DI*`.  The last of the `DIDescriptor` classes were deleted in
r235356, and the last of the related typedefs removed in r235413, so
this has all baked for about a week.

Note: If you have out-of-tree code (like a frontend), I recommend that
you get everything compiling and tests passing with the *previous*
commit before updating to this one.  It'll be easier to keep track of
what code is using the `DIDescriptor` hierarchy and what you've already
updated, and I think you're extremely unlikely to insert bugs.  YMMV of
course.

Back to *this* commit: I did this using the rename-md-di-nodes.sh
upgrade script I've attached to PR23080 (both code and testcases) and
filtered through clang-format-diff.py.  I edited the tests for
test/Assembler/invalid-generic-debug-node-*.ll by hand since the columns
were off-by-three.  It should work on your out-of-tree testcases (and
code, if you've followed the advice in the previous paragraph).

Some of the tests are in badly named files now (e.g.,
test/Assembler/invalid-mdcompositetype-missing-tag.ll should be
'dicompositetype'); I'll come back and move the files in a follow-up
commit.

; RUN: llvm-as < %s | llvm-dis | llvm-as | llvm-dis | FileCheck %s
; RUN: verify-uselistorder %s
; CHECK: !named = !{!0, !1, !2, !3, !4, !5, !6, !7, !7, !8, !8}
!named = !{!0, !1, !2, !3, !4, !5, !6, !7, !8, !9, !10}
!0 = distinct !{}
!1 = !DIFile(filename: "path/to/file", directory: "/path/to/dir")
!2 = distinct !{}
!3 = distinct !{}
!4 = distinct !{}
!5 = distinct !{}
!6 = distinct !{}
; CHECK: !7 = !DICompileUnit(language: DW_LANG_C99, file: !1, producer: "clang", isOptimized: true, flags: "-O2", runtimeVersion: 2, splitDebugFilename: "abc.debug", emissionKind: 3, enums: !2, retainedTypes: !3, subprograms: !4, globals: !5, imports: !6)
!7 = !DICompileUnit(language: DW_LANG_C99, file: !1, producer: "clang",
isOptimized: true, flags: "-O2", runtimeVersion: 2,
splitDebugFilename: "abc.debug", emissionKind: 3,
enums: !2, retainedTypes: !3, subprograms: !4,
globals: !5, imports: !6)
!8 = !DICompileUnit(language: 12, file: !1, producer: "clang",
isOptimized: true, flags: "-O2", runtimeVersion: 2,
splitDebugFilename: "abc.debug", emissionKind: 3,
enums: !2, retainedTypes: !3, subprograms: !4,
globals: !5, imports: !6)
; CHECK: !8 = !DICompileUnit(language: DW_LANG_C99, file: !1, isOptimized: false, runtimeVersion: 0, emissionKind: 0)
!9 = !DICompileUnit(language: 12, file: !1, producer: "",
isOptimized: false, flags: "", runtimeVersion: 0,
splitDebugFilename: "", emissionKind: 0)
!10 = !DICompileUnit(language: 12, file: !1)
